What Is OfQual and What Does It Do?
OfQual (the Office of Qualifications and Examinations Regulation) is the independent government regulator of qualifications, examinations, and assessments in England. Established under the Apprenticeships, Skills, Children and Learning Act 2009, OfQual ensures that regulated qualifications are of a consistent and reliable standard, providing learners and employers with confidence that a qualification represents genuine achievement. What Is the Regulated Qualifications Framework (RQF)?
The RQF is the system used by OfQual to classify qualifications in England and Northern Ireland by their difficulty level and size (credit value). It replaced the Qualifications and Credit Framework (QCF) in October 2015, providing a simpler and more flexible approach to qualification design. The RQF has nine levels, from Entry Level to Level 8, with each level representing an increasing degree of difficulty and complexity.
| RQF Level | Qualification Type | Example | EQF Equivalent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Entry Level | Entry Level Certificate | Skills for Life | EQF 1 |
| Level 1 | GCSE (grades 3–1) | GCSE English | EQF 2 |
| Level 2 | GCSE (grades 9–4) | GCSE Maths | EQF 3 |
| Level 3 | A Level | A Level Business | EQF 4 |
| Level 4 | Certificate of Higher Education | HNC | EQF 5 |
| Level 5 | Foundation Degree | HND, FdA | EQF 5 |
| Level 6 | Bachelor's Degree | BA, BSc | EQF 6 |
| Level 7 | Master's Degree / Postgraduate Diploma | MA, MSc, Level 7 Diploma | EQF 7 |
| Level 8 | Doctoral Degree | PhD, DBA | EQF 8 |

What Is the Role of Awarding Organisations Like OTHM?
Awarding organisations are the bodies recognised by OfQual to develop, deliver, and award regulated qualifications. OTHM Qualifications is one such recognised awarding organisation, authorised to offer qualifications from Level 3 to Level 7 across a range of business and management disciplines. OfQual regularly audits awarding organisations to ensure they maintain the required standards for qualification design, assessment quality, and learner support.
